Emotional Intelligence
The ability to recognize, manage, and convey one's own feelings, as well as to navigate social interactions wisely and with empathy.
Job Insecurity
The fear or concern of losing one's job, often due to economic factors or organizational changes, leading to stress and anxiety.

According to the review of many studies, workers with low emotional intelligence when faced with job insecurity are more likely to experience negative emotional reactions. They may feel anxiety, depression, and stress which can lead to decreased job performance and an increase in absenteeism.
